Use the comedi_subdevice 'readback' member and the core provided (*insn_read)
to handle the readback of the write-only dac08 calib subdevice. Remove the
then unused 'dac08_value' member from the private data.

The dac08 calib subdevice only has one channel. For consistency in the driver,
modify the subdevice init so that a loop is used to initialize the channels and
readback values.
